Strategic Sourcing: The Foundation of Effective Procurement

 

Strategic sourcing is far more than simply choosing suppliers. It involves a methodical approach aimed at developing long-term supplier relationships, mitigating risks, and improving overall cost efficiency. Done well, it can become a key driver of competitive advantage.

 

Key Benefits of Strategic Sourcing

 

  1. Building Long-Term Supplier Partnerships Strategic sourcing focuses on identifying and collaborating with suppliers who align with a company’s long-term goals. By fostering these relationships, businesses can ensure stable supply chains, consistent quality, and even access to supplier innovations. According to a McKinsey report, firms that develop strong supplier partnerships are 35% less likely to experience significant supply disruptions.
  2. Improving Cost and Quality Every decision in strategic sourcing impacts the total cost of ownership, the quality of goods or services, and supply chain resilience. By engaging in rigorous supplier selection and negotiation, companies can secure better pricing and ensure higher quality standards. A 2023 Deloitte study revealed that companies using strategic sourcing models saw a 15% reduction in procurement costs.
  3. Risk Mitigation and Resilience Building Strategic sourcing identifies potential risks in the supply chain—whether from geopolitical issues, natural disasters, or supplier insolvency—and proactively mitigates them. The recent semiconductor shortage highlighted the importance of sourcing diversification. Companies with strategic sourcing strategies in place were able to avoid production stoppages by having alternative suppliers ready.
  4. Driving Innovation Strong supplier relationships can lead to joint innovation efforts. Moreover, early supplier involvement in product development helps businesses reduce time-to-market, improve product quality, and lower costs. Studies show that involving suppliers early can reduce development costs by 10-20%.
  5. Enhancing Competitive Advantage Strategic sourcing creates a sustainable competitive edge by combining cost savings, risk management, and supplier innovation. Additionally, it enables companies to remain agile, competitive, and profitable in dynamic markets.

Innovative Solutions: Enhancing Procurement Efficiency

 

While strategic sourcing focuses on supplier relationships and long-term goals, innovative solutions bring technology-driven efficiency and insight to procurement processes. However, these solutions use data analytics, automation, and predictive modeling to streamline operations, enabling procurement teams to make faster and more informed decisions.

 

Key Benefits of Smart Solutions

 

  1. Data-Driven Decision-Making Smart solutions provide real-time data analysis, offering insights into market trends, supplier performance, and pricing fluctuations. This allows procurement professionals to base their decisions on hard evidence rather than intuition. According to Gartner, organizations that leverage data-driven procurement see a 20% improvement in decision accuracy.
  2. Automation of Routine Tasks Repetitive tasks such as purchase order creation, invoice processing, and supplier performance tracking can be automated, freeing up time for procurement teams to focus on strategic initiatives. A study by Hackett Group found that companies using automated procurement tools reduced their operational costs by 25%.
  3. Predictive Risk Management Smart solutions equipped with predictive analytics can help foresee potential risks—such as supplier insolvency or geopolitical events—before they occur. Moreover, early warnings allow procurement teams to take pre-emptive actions, ensuring continuity of supply.
  4. Supplier Performance Monitoring Continuous monitoring of supplier performance is crucial for maintaining high standards. However, innovative solutions provide dashboards and key performance indicators (KPIs) that track delivery times, defect rates, and compliance levels, ensuring suppliers meet agreed expectations.
  5. Optimizing Procurement Beyond Cost Traditional procurement tends to prioritize cost above all else. However, innovative solutions enable procurement teams to optimize based on multiple criteria, such as sustainability, quality, and innovation potential. Moreover, this holistic approach ensures that procurement decisions contribute to the company’s overall strategic goals.

Bringing It All Together: Strategic Sourcing + Smart Solutions

 

However, the real magic happens when strategic sourcing and innovative solutions are combined. Together, they create a comprehensive procurement strategy that leverages both human insight and technological efficiency.

 

  • Strategic sourcing builds long-term relationships, fosters trust, and ensures stability.
  • Innovative solutions provide speed, data-driven insights, and predictive capabilities.

 

This combination results in:

 

  • Higher Procurement Efficiency: Companies leveraging both approaches report a 40% increase in overall procurement efficiency.
  • Greater Supplier Satisfaction: Engaged suppliers who see the value in a long-term partnership are more willing to collaborate and innovate.
  • Improved Risk Management: Combining human judgment with predictive tools enhances the ability to foresee and mitigate risks.

 

Steps to Implement an Integrated Approach

 

To achieve the best results, procurement leaders should follow these steps to integrate strategic sourcing with innovative solutions:

 

  1. Conduct a Procurement Maturity Assessmentbegin by assessing your current procurement strategy and technology stack. Identify gaps in your supplier management processes and technological capabilities.
  2. Invest in the Right Technologies Choose innovative solutions that align with your strategic goals. Look for tools that offer advanced analytics, automation, and integration capabilities. Ensure that these tools can scale with your business.
  3. Develop Supplier Collaboration Frameworks, engage key suppliers in strategic discussions, develop joint value-creation initiatives, and establish clear performance metrics to ensure mutual growth.
  4. Upskill Your Procurement Team Equip your procurement professionals with the skills needed to use innovative solutions effectively. Additionally, provide training on both the technical aspects of these tools and the strategic elements of supplier relationship management.
  5. Measure and Refine Continuously monitor the impact of your integrated approach. Use KPIs to measure performance, identify areas for improvement, and refine your strategy over time.

 

Real-World Success Stories

 

Several companies have already reaped the benefits of combining strategic sourcing with innovative solutions:

 

  • Consumer Electronics Firm: By integrating innovative procurement tools with its strategic sourcing framework, a leading electronics firm reduced supplier lead times by 15% and improved product launch timelines.
  • Automotive Manufacturer: To address supply chain disruptions, an automotive company used predictive analytics to identify at-risk suppliers and secure alternative sources, ensuring uninterrupted production.
  • FMCG Company: A fast-moving consumer goods company implemented automated supplier scorecards, leading to a 20% improvement in supplier compliance and reduced defect rates.
